Sealed boxes benefit from being stuffed with fiberfill which is found at fabric stores. The general rule of thumb is to add 1lb fiberfill per cubic foot of box space. It basically makes the sub think it's in a bigger box than it actually is, lowering the Q factor and making the bass deeper.
